Compañía

CognizantVer más

addressDirecciónFlorida, Entre Ríos
CategoríaIngeniería

Descripción del trabajo

Automotive Embedded Firmware Engineer

 

About Cognizant’s Mobility Practice:

Cognizant Mobility is the premier automotive engineering services division of Cognizant that is focused on smart connected vehicle engineering and software delivery.  Our clients include well known Automotive OEMs and Electric/Autonomous Start Up Companies that leverage our automotive engineering expertise.

We are looking for talented engineers with backgrounds in Electrical and Computer Engineering for such roles as Vehicle Systems Engineering, Electrical Design and Release, High Voltage Wire Harness Design and Packaging, Embedded Software Development and Algorithm Research, AUTOSAR Model Based System Design, Validation, Hardware in the Loop Integration, Functional Safety, Vehicle Triage, SWAT and Launch Support, etc. 

Summary:

You will be involved in the design, implementation, and validation of Embedded Firmware and drivers for a variety of vehicle features, such as:  starting, locking, lighting, alarms, windows, powered closures, seats, climate control, and others.  In this role Engineers will focus on firmware and driver development and integration using Embedded C to deploy on FreeRTOS and QNX RTOS.

What you will be able to do:

  • Design embedded bootloaders, firmware and drivers that will execute in ETAS implementation of QNX RTOS and FreeRTOS

  • Follow software coding standards, meet MISRA guidelines, and follow other best practices

  • Design and develop software for a System on Chip (SoC) solution consisting of multiple operating environments (POSIX, RTOS, bare metal) and processing cores (MPU, MCU, DSP) interfacing with devices through common peripheral buses (SPI, I2C, CAN, PCIe, MIPI CSI, SERDES, Ethernet, UART)

  • Design and develop QNX and FreeRTOS device drivers using C

  • Design and develop Classic AUTOSAR services and Complex Device Drivers (CDD) using C

  • Debug HW-SW interfacing issues for root cause identification using common tools and methods (JTAG, oscilloscope, logic analyzer, Lauterbach)

  • Work with a cross-functional team, developing, and capturing requirements for customer interfacing features and technologies

  • Develop Complex Device Drivers (CDD) and configure basic software components

Minimum Qualifications:

  • BS in Electrical Engineering, Computer Engineering, Computer Science, or related field

  • 2+ years of experience in software development in C

  • 2+ year of bootloader, firmware and device driver development in Communication Services, Memory Services, System Services, and Complex Device Drivers

Preferred Qualifications:

  • MS in Electrical Engineering, Computer Engineering, Computer Science, or related field

  • Experience with Jama, Polarion, Clearcase, Git, Gitbhub, JIRA, Agile, MISRA C/C++

  • Development with ETAS Toolchain including ETAS ASCET

Employee Status : Full Time Employee

Shift : Day Job

Travel : No

Job Posting : Jan 03 2024

About Cognizant

Cognizant (Nasdaq-100: CTSH) is one of the world's leading professional services companies, transforming clients' business, operating and technology models for the digital era. Our unique industry-based, consultative approach helps clients envision, build and run more innovative and efficient businesses. Headquartered in the U.S., Cognizant is ranked 185 on the Fortune 500 and is consistently listed among the most admired companies in the world. Learn how Cognizant helps clients lead with digital at www.cognizant.com or follow us @USJobsCognizant.

Applicants may be required to attend interviews in person or by video conference. In addition, candidates may be required to present their current state or government issued ID during each interview.

Cognizant is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to sex, gender identity, sexual orientation, race, color, religion, national origin, disability, protected Veteran status, age, or any other characteristic protected by law.

If you have a disability that requires a reasonable accommodation to search for a job opening or submit an application, please email CareersNA2@cognizant.com with your request and contact information.

Refer code: 501160. Cognizant - El día anterior - 2024-01-04 06:20

Cognizant

Florida, Entre Ríos

Compartir trabajos con amigos